Civil Science is currently seeking a qualified Water/Wastewater Project Manager to join our St George, Utah team. This candidate will lead and manage a diverse range of water and wastewater related projects. The successful candidate will be responsible for overseeing the planning, design, and implementation of projects, ensuring that they are completed on time, within budget, and to the highest quality standards. In this role, you will work collaboratively with your team to coordinate and manage both engineering projects and growing our regional presence. The candidate will work with local and regional leadership to take advantage of marketing and business development opportunities in the region, expand our client base, secure new water /wastewater projects and enhance market presence.

Responsibilities

  • Lead the planning, design, and execution of water and wastewater projects, including treatment plants, pipelines, pump stations, distribution systems, and water quality improvement.
  • Manage multidisciplinary project teams, including engineers and technicians, to deliver successful project outcomes.
  • Develop and maintain project schedules, budgets, and resource plans.
  • Conduct technical reviews and ensure compliance with industry standards and regulatory requirements.
  • Prepare and present project proposals, reports, and technical documents.
  • Build and maintain strong relationships with existing and potential clients.
  • Develop and execute marketing plans to promote services and capabilities.
  • Identify and develop new business opportunities and strategies to increase market share and secure new projects.
  • Mentor and develop junior staff members, fostering a collaborative and innovative work environment.
  • Bachelor’s degree in Civil Engineering, Environmental Engineering, or a related field.
  • Professional Engineer (PE) license is required.
  • Minimum of 10 years of experience in water/wastewater engineering, with a focus on project management.
  • Proven experience in managing complex water/ wastewater projects from inception to completion.
  • Strong technical knowledge in hydraulics with experience in water rights, source capacity, storage, collection, treatment, distribution, and transmission.
  • Proficiency in relevant software tools such as AutoCAD and GIS.
